  7. Did a small update on the Nexon All-Stars concept with a new Limited PVE Event Map which is a recreation of Desert Fox from Combat Arms. Here is a preview of it. I tried to make it faithful to the original map while keeping the limitations of MicroVolts gameplay in mind and making it F2P friendly. Desert Fox (Combat Arms) Description One of the more unique Fireteam maps from Combat Arms is here! Shoot your way through the labyrinth to find the dastardly Terrorist Z! Differences from the original game Due to MicroVolts not having a proper sprint mechanic, Terrorist Z will not sprint but instead have his walk speed increased by 25%. Z will also fight back occasionally, to make chasing him more difficult. Stages Stage 1 The player(s) must locate Z while killing the Sand Hog militants. The player(s) will have a choice of capturing Z alive or killing him. Stage 2 If any player captures Z, you and your team will be tasked to plant the bomb near a truck. The team must protect the bomb for 3 minutes. If any player kills Z, then there will be an enemy ambush at the team, who must survive for 5 minutes. Stage 3 This stage has the player and his/her team destroy 3 Anti Air by planting each bomb near them. Stage 4 After reaching the extraction point, the player and his/her team fight off an ambush until the rescue squad appears. Rewards Terrorist Z Set (Helmetless) (Kai) (Permanent) Terrorist Z Set (w/ Helmet) (Kai) (Permanent) I also added a new diorama idea based on the popular but closed QuizQuiz/Q-Play.
